What this record shows

This record is dominated by other: $60,780 of the $64,414 with a category attached, or 94.4%. Acera Surgical, Inc. accounts for 94.5% of it on its own, with 23 other manufacturers making up the rest. Reporting peaked in 2022 at $61,231 and has fallen 99.1% since, to $539 in 2025. Among primary podiatric medicine clinicians in FL with any reported payments, this total sits in the top 5% — high for the specialty, which is a reason to read the composition above rather than the number alone.

What this is not: this is the amount Original Medicare Part B allowed for services this provider billed in 2024. It is not their income. It excludes Medicare Advantage — now more than half of all Medicare enrollment — along with Medicaid and all commercial insurance, and it is gross practice revenue before staff, rent, supplies and malpractice premiums. CMS also suppresses any figure covering ten or fewer patients, so low-volume providers appear smaller than they are.
